> The number of failed RemoteManager unit tests seems to vary widely and
> randomly, sometimes many fail; at other times, much less. Examining some of
> the failures (in the unit test report files), they all seem to be at points
> where the output (such as a "Welcome" line) from the remote manager is
> compared to the expected one by the test case.
> At first thought that it might be an issue with the default restricted Vista
> user not being able to open certain port numbers, but it the same occurs when
> "build.bat clean run-unit-tests" is run from a command prompt with admin
> privileges.
> Easy to reproduce, ran multiple times and failures were always > 0.
